#e810ee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e810ee is composed of 91% red, 6.3%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.5% cyan, 93.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 298.4 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 49.8%. #e810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20ff with #d100dd. Closest websafe color is: #ff00ff.

#e810ee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e810ee has RGB values of R:232, G:16,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15208686.
